LG in Pleasanton
Pleasanton breaks into two patterns, and LG fits both differently. The historic downtown homes from the early 1900s through the 1930s often have no ductwork, plaster walls, and limited electrical, which makes them natural ductless territory. LG's Art Cool and standard ductless heads add cooling and heating to these homes without tearing into period plaster, and the design-conscious heads matter to owners who care how a wall unit reads in an older interior. The newer Vintage Hills, Foothill, and tract neighborhoods are more often heat pump conversions on systems in the 25-to-40-year replacement window.
Pleasanton sits inland in the Tri-Valley, and the summers are serious. The afternoons get hot and dry, so AC systems carry heavy load. The cooling side of any LG system here has to be sized to that load, not guessed by square footage, or it will run hard and underperform on the worst afternoons. The mild winters mean a standard LG heat pump covers heating efficiently without cold-climate equipment. LG sits in the value-to-mid tier, a sensible match for the tract homes, with ThinQ app control as a real convenience for managing cooling remotely.
The honest tradeoff is that LG runs electronics-heavy, so its failures lean toward boards and communication faults rather than simple mechanical parts. That is a different pattern from the capacitor and aging-refrigerant problems we see on the old tract systems. On a single-zone LG it rarely matters. On a multi-zone install in a Ruby Hill or East Pleasanton estate the electronics are where the service time goes, and we put that on the estimate before you buy.
LG work we do in Pleasanton
Ductless retrofits in historic downtown homes. Downtown Pleasanton homes from the early 1900s often have no ductwork, plaster walls, and limited electrical. We install LG ductless to add heating and cooling without opening up period walls, and we check electrical capacity at the estimate since these homes frequently need a panel evaluation.
Heat pump conversions in the tract neighborhoods. Vintage Hills and Foothill tract homes with 25-to-40-year-old systems are common LG heat pump conversions. We run the load calculation for the real summer cooling demand, check the panel, and confirm whether the existing ducts are worth keeping before quoting.
Summer capacitor and refrigerant failures. Pleasanton's hot summers push AC hard. The most common failure on aging systems is a degraded capacitor, and we carry replacements on the truck. On old R-22 systems we run the replacement numbers, because the refrigerant is expensive and getting scarcer and a system that leaked once will leak again.
Estate multi-zone diagnostics. In Ruby Hill and East Pleasanton custom homes, LG multi-zone systems throw communication and board faults that need code-level work. We read the error, isolate board versus sensor versus wiring, and confirm any HOA rules on exterior equipment placement before we set the condenser.
